Having a hard time finishing your holiday shopping? Here’s a thought. How about getting your sister a goat. Maybe a bag of manure for your best friend, or a can of worms for your mom. . . and you don’t even have to fight for a parking space at the mall! All you have to do is visit Oxfam America Unwrapped.
The best part? You don’t have to pay any outrageous shipping fees, because Oxfam will deliver the items to the places where they’re needed most. The “giftee” will get a lovely card and you’ll the satisfaction of knowing that you helped feed a child somewhere in the world.
It doesn’t take much to make a difference to a child who is living poverty. For under $25 dollars you can buy soap, blankets, seeds, and books (because kids need food for their minds as well as their tummies.) Or ask your family and friends to chip in and buy a village a pair of sheep for only $90.
